Ansei

Ansei (安政) was a Japanese era after Kaei and before Man'en and spanned from November 27 (?), 1854 to March 18 (?), 1860. The reigning emperor was Komei.

Change of Era

Due to the disasters of a fire at the Imperial Palace, earthquakes, and the arrival of the Black Ships (Commodore Perry's ships), the era was changed to Ansei (roughly "Quiet/peaceful Government")

Source of Name

From a quote "庶民安政、然後君子安位矣" ("Peaceful rule of the masses, peaceful succession"??)

Events

The Ansei Purge took place in 5th (1858) and 6th (1859) year of Ansei era.
